12.4.3 Configuring For IMA Operations
All IMA timeouts are programmable. In general, the default values result in ~1
sec timeouts with a 55 MHz SYSCLK.
The global IMA interrupt enables default to disabled. In an interrupt driven
system, these interrupt should be selectively enabled in registers 0x218, 0x21A,
and 0x21C.
RIPP_EN in Register –x200 controls whether internal IMA state machines engine
is enabled. This must be set for proper operation.
IMA groups are configured using the following per group tables:
RIPP Group Configuration Record
: Group options and configuration,
TIMA TX-LID-to-Physcial-Link Mapping Table: maps Group Tag/LID to
physical Link.
TIMA TX Group Configuration Record
: maps group to Any-PHY/UTOPIA
port ID, sets stuffing mode and OAM label.
RDAT IMA Group Context Record
: maps group to Any-PHY/UTOPIA port ID
and also the following per link tables:
RIPP TX Link Configuration Record
: maps physical Link to Group Tag/LID,
enables TX Link Interrupts.
RIPP RX Link Configuration Record
: maps physical Link to Group Tag,
enables RX link interrupts
TIMA TX Physical Link Context Record: sets ICP offset.
RDAT Link Context Record
: maps physical link to group.
